Janice was born to the late James Dye and the late Clentell Remley in Talladega, AL. Her family moved from Savannah, GA in the early 1960’s and she graduated from the Academy of Richmond County in 1966. After high school Janice married and became an Army wife, living in several different states and countries but always returning “home” to Augusta, GA. She worked in various retail stores and medical offices but was most proud of her medical coding work and eventual retirement from the Medical College of Georgia hospital.
She later married the late Rev. Joseph Borgkvist, Jr. and moved to the West Columbia, SC area where they spent nearly 17 happy years together. She was a member of Fellowship Baptist Church in Lexington, SC.
Janice was a woman of God and could always be found smiling, she had a laugh that was contagious and could light up any room.
